The number of building permits granted for housing rose slightly in January, by 1.5% month-on-month, to 29,000, according to provisional data published on Friday by the Ministry of Planning and Decentralization. This level is still 25% below the average for the twelve months prior to the 2020 Covid health crisis, points out the Ministry's Service des données et études statistiques (SDES).
